
Cyberpunk 2077: A Retro Movie Concept Takes Shape
With today's advanced technology, creating compelling concepts is easier than ever. A recent example is the burgeoning interest in a retro-styled Cyberpunk 2077 movie adaptation.
Utilizing modern technology, several tech enthusiasts have developed a concept showcasing Cyberpunk 2077 in a unique way. YouTube channel Sora AI, known for creative experiments, presents a screen adaptation of the CD Projekt RED hit, reimagining familiar characters in a style reminiscent of 1980s action films.
While some characters undergo significant stylistic changes, they remain easily identifiable. The concept includes characters from both the base game and the Phantom Liberty expansion.
The significant leap in DLSS 4 technology, particularly its new Vision Transformer model, has resulted in a substantial improvement in image quality for super-resolution and ray reconstruction. The enhanced frame generation, producing two or three intermediate frames instead of one, further boosts performance.
Testing DLSS 4's capabilities on an RTX 5080 with an updated Cyberpunk 2077 version and path tracing enabled yielded impressive results: a consistent frame rate exceeding 120 fps at 4K resolution. This highlights the significant performance gains offered by DLSS 4.
